The wait is finally over as 11 episodes are now streaming on ALTBalaji and ZEE5 app. Based on celebrated author Manju Kapur's bestseller novel 'A Married Woman', the show dives deep into the characters of Astha and Peeplika. In the nineteen nineties, the story revolves around Astha, an ideal wife, daughter-in-law, and a perfect mother; who has everything a woman can hope from her marriage- a responsible husband, in-laws, and two children, yet she feels incomplete as an individual.

Breaking the normal society's norms, she sets out on a journey of self-discovery and finds her path. Thus ensues the story and the journey of a married woman. Peeplika, on the other hand, is a complete contrast, an artist who's never been interested in anything the least bit conventional who helps her explore her path on self-discovery.

The series, directed by Sahir Raza, features a talented pool of actors like Ridhi Dogra and Monica Dogra and Imaad Shah, Ayesha Raza, Rahul Vohra, Divya Seth Shah, Nadira Babbar, and Suhaas Ahuja, among others.
